Web2 de jan. de 2024 · The mean is 75, so the center is 75. The standard deviation is 5, so for each line above the mean add 5 and for each line below the mean subtract 5. The graph looks like the following: Figure 2.4. 2: Empirical Rule for Example 2.4. 1. From the graph we can see that 95% of the students had scores between 65 and 85. http://pressbooks-dev.oer.hawaii.edu/introductorystatistics/chapter/using-the-normal-distribution/ WebFor nearly normally distributed data, about 68% falls within 1 SD of the mean, about 95% falls within 2 SD of the mean, about 99.7% falls within 3 SD of the mean. It is possible for observations to fall 4, 5, or more standard deviations away from the mean, but these occurrences are very rare if the data are nearly normal.
